AI-driven, real-time decisioning is supplanting campaign-and-segment-led engagement in iGaming, shifting operators toward one-to-one micro-interactions ('nudges') delivered within existing stacks. Expected outcomes include improved retention, more efficient incentive allocation and lower operational burden driven by continuous model learning; competitive advantage will hinge on speed and precision of decision-making. Implementation is additive (a decision layer atop current CRM/comms systems) and emphasizes strategy and creative quality over manual campaign management.
AI decisioning converges two sustainable advantages: scale of first‑party behavioural data and low‑latency execution. Operators with large active pools and multi‑product footprints can convert the same incentive dollar into 20–40% fewer offers while sustaining or improving retention by 5–15% within 6–18 months, translating into an immediate 2–6 percentage‑point EBITDA uplift at fixed margins. The technology stack winners will be infra and real‑time data providers (feature stores, streaming, model serving) rather than legacy CRM suppliers: the marginal dollar now buys milliseconds of personalization, not broader campaign reach, creating a winner‑take‑most dynamic where platform effects accelerate model quality and reduce per‑player acquisition/retention costs. Expect cloud spend to rise as a share of revenue (real‑time inference, retraining cadence), offset by lower variable promo spend — a near‑term reallocation of OpEx toward engineering and creative. Regulatory and operational frictions are the key limiter: algorithmic nudging invites regulatory scrutiny on responsible gaming and profiling (enforcement windows 6–24 months), while model failures or latency events create outsized reputational and revenue hits in live betting cycles. The practical arbitrage is speed: firms that execute a robust MLOps + guardrails program in the next 12 months lock in persistent unit economics improvements that are hard to replicate laterally without similar data scale and product integration.
